news 2026/6/10 11:07:20

VMware macOS解锁实战:从零到精通的全流程指南 [特殊字符]

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
VMware macOS解锁实战:从零到精通的全流程指南 [特殊字符]

想在普通Windows或Linux电脑上流畅运行macOS虚拟机吗?VMware Unlocker就是您需要的工具!这款强大的解锁工具能够绕过VMware的限制,让您在非Apple硬件上完美体验macOS系统。无论您是开发者需要跨平台测试,还是技术爱好者想要探索不同操作系统,这篇指南都能帮您轻松实现目标。😊

【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unlo/unlocker

准备工作:环境检查与前置条件

在开始解锁之前,请确保您的环境满足以下要求:

必备条件清单

  • VMware Workstation 11-17 或 Player 7-17版本
  • Windows系统需要管理员权限
  • Linux系统需要root或sudo权限
  • 确保关闭所有VMware相关进程

系统兼容性矩阵

操作系统所需权限推荐VMware版本
Windows管理员权限Workstation 16-17
Linuxroot/sudo权限Workstation 15-17

第一步:获取解锁工具

首先需要下载Unlocker项目文件:

git clone https://gitcode.com/gh_mirrors/unlo/unlocker

项目结构解析

  • win-install.cmd- Windows系统安装脚本
  • lnx-install.sh- Linux系统安装脚本
  • win-uninstall.cmd- Windows卸载脚本
  • lnx-uninstall.sh- Linux卸载脚本

第二步:执行解锁操作

Windows用户操作指南

  1. 权限准备:右键点击win-install.cmd文件
  2. 执行安装:选择"以管理员身份运行"
  3. 等待完成:脚本会自动完成所有修补工作

Linux用户操作指南

  1. 权限设置

    chmod +x lnx-install.sh
  2. 执行安装

    sudo ./lnx-install.sh

关键提示:Linux用户如果遇到Python版本问题,可以使用以下命令指定版本:

PYVERSION=python3.7 ./lnx-install.sh

第三步:验证安装效果

安装完成后,重启VMware软件。在创建新虚拟机时,您应该能在操作系统列表中看到Apple macOS相关选项,这表明解锁成功!🎉

常见问题快速解决方案

问题一:VMware启动失败

症状:安装Unlocker后VMware无法正常启动

解决方案:运行对应的卸载脚本清理残留文件

操作系统卸载命令
Windowswin-uninstall.cmd
Linuxsudo ./lnx-uninstall.sh

问题二:虚拟机创建崩溃

症状:在创建macOS虚拟机时系统崩溃

解决方案

  1. 降低虚拟机硬件兼容性版本
  2. 或者在虚拟机配置文件中添加:
    smc.version = "0"

问题三:VMware Tools无法安装

症状:系统无法自动识别darwin.iso文件

解决方案

  1. 在虚拟机设置中手动选择CD/DVD设备
  2. 指定项目目录中的darwin.iso文件路径
  3. 在macOS系统中手动安装VMware Tools

工具维护与更新策略

为了确保最佳的兼容性和性能,建议定期更新macOS支持组件:

更新操作

操作系统更新命令
Windowswin-update-tools.cmd
Linuxsudo ./lnx-update-tools.sh

进阶技巧:版本管理与故障排查

版本升级注意事项

⚠️重要提醒:在安装新版Unlocker之前,务必先运行卸载脚本清理旧版本,否则可能导致VMware无法正常工作。

环境变量配置技巧

对于特殊环境,可以通过设置环境变量来调整工具行为:

export PYVERSION=python3.8 sudo ./lnx-install.sh

项目发展历程

Unlocker项目自2011年发布以来,经历了多个重要版本更新:

  • 最新版本3.1.1:完美适配VMware 17和最新macOS系统
  • 2025年3月:修复了"VMware was unexpected"错误
  • 2024年5月:解决了HTTP 403下载限制问题

完整的版本历史记录可以在项目根目录的VERSION文件中查看。

总结与展望

通过本指南的详细步骤,您已经掌握了使用VMware Unlocker在普通PC上运行macOS虚拟机的完整技能。从环境准备到安装执行,从问题排查到工具维护,每个环节都为您提供了清晰的指导。

现在,您可以在自己的电脑上畅享macOS系统的魅力,无论是进行iOS开发测试,还是体验macOS的独特功能,Unlocker都能为您提供稳定可靠的技术支持。立即开始您的macOS虚拟化之旅,开启跨平台开发的无限可能!🌟

【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unlo/unlocker

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/9 22:06:50

RPFM模组工具完整使用指南:从新手到专家的实战教程

RPFM模组工具完整使用指南:从新手到专家的实战教程 【免费下载链接】rpfm Rusted PackFile Manager (RPFM) is a... reimplementation in Rust and Qt5 of PackFile Manager (PFM), one of the best modding tools for Total War Games. 项目地址: https://gitcod…

作者头像 李华
网站建设 2026/6/2 18:47:45

Multisim汉化图解说明:一步步带你操作

Multisim汉化实战指南:从零开始,轻松搞定中文界面你是不是也曾在打开Multisim时,面对满屏的英文菜单感到头大?“Place Component”、“Simulate → Run”、“Netlist Generation”……这些术语对初学者来说就像一堵语言墙&#xf…

作者头像 李华
网站建设 2026/5/31 16:08:20

英雄联盟智能助手:如何从青铜逆袭王者的实用指南

英雄联盟智能助手:如何从青铜逆袭王者的实用指南 【免费下载链接】League-Toolkit 兴趣使然的、简单易用的英雄联盟工具集。支持战绩查询、自动秒选等功能。基于 LCU API。 项目地址: https://gitcode.com/gh_mirrors/le/League-Toolkit 还在为每次排位赛选人…

作者头像 李华
网站建设 2026/5/30 6:48:55

3分钟解锁网易云音乐灰色歌曲:开源神器终极实战指南

Unlock-netease-cloud-music 是一款专为解决网易云音乐灰色歌曲播放难题而生的开源神器。通过智能音源替换技术,这款工具能够自动将无法播放的灰色歌曲转换为可正常播放状态,让您重新享受完整音乐体验。 【免费下载链接】Unlock-netease-cloud-music 解锁…

作者头像 李华
网站建设 2026/6/7 15:32:23

BiliBili-UWP完全使用指南:5分钟上手Windows最佳B站客户端

BiliBili-UWP完全使用指南:5分钟上手Windows最佳B站客户端 【免费下载链接】BiliBili-UWP BiliBili的UWP客户端,当然,是第三方的了 项目地址: https://gitcode.com/gh_mirrors/bi/BiliBili-UWP 还在为网页版B站卡顿、广告多而烦恼吗&a…

作者头像 李华
网站建设 2026/5/30 20:24:48

Source Sans 3 完整使用指南:打造专业级界面字体方案

Source Sans 3 完整使用指南:打造专业级界面字体方案 【免费下载链接】source-sans Sans serif font family for user interface environments 项目地址: https://gitcode.com/gh_mirrors/so/source-sans Source Sans 3 是 Adobe 精心打造的开源无衬线字体家…

作者头像 李华